MILAN, Italy -- Inter Milan beat Serie B side Hellas Verona 2-0 to advance to the Italian Cup quarterfinals on Tuesday.

Antonio Cassano put Inter ahead in the 50th after taking a pass from Fredy Guarin. Four minutes later, Guarin scored with a free kick that deflected in off Verona's wall at the San Siro.

Inter played the final 10 minutes with 10 men after goalkeeper Luca Castellazzi was carried off on a stretcher with an injury, as the home side had used all three of its substitutions. Forward Rodrigo Palacio ended the match in goal, and performed admirably by saving a header.

Inter will next face either Napoli or Bologna, who play Wednesday.

Fans clashed outside the stadium before the match and had to be separated by police.
